The Fabelmans (12a)

Dir: Steven Spielberg | USA | 2022 | 151 mins
Cast | Michelle Williams, Paul Dano, Seth Rogen, Gabriel LaBelle, Judd Hirsch

 Dedicated to the memory of his parents, Steven Spielberg’s wistful coming-of-age drama – co-written with Tony Kushner, soundtracked by John Williams and featuring cinematography by Janusz Kamiński – tells the semi-autobiographical story of a young aspiring filmmaker.

Post-World War II Arizona: Sammy Fabelman (Gabriel LaBelle) falls in love with the movies after his parents, pianist Mitzi (an Oscar-tipped Michelle Williams) and computer engineer Burt (Paul Dano) take him to see The Greatest Show on Earth. Armed with a camera, Sammy starts to make his own films at home, much to Mitzi’s supportive delight – finding out early, in ways happy and sad, the power of cinema to reveal the truth.

Featuring Seth Rogen, Judd Hirsch and Jeannie Berlin (plus a David Lynch cameo as director John Ford), The Fabelmans shows Spielberg in easy and reflective mode, gracefully exploring the family dynamics that saw him become one of the world’s most beloved filmmakers. A gorgeous revival of his childhood era, it’s a warm, funny and highly personal look at family and the wonder of film.
